Step 1: Assessment and Planning
Our team will assess the damage and create a customized plan to extract the water and dry out the area. We’ll identify the source of the leak and make any necessary repairs.
Step 2: Water Extraction
Using advanced equipment, including wet/dry vacuums and submersible pumps, we’ll extract the water from your basement and begin the drying process. We’ll work quickly to reduce damage and prevent further issues.
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ification
We’ll use specialized equipment, including dehumidifiers and drying fans, to remove excess moisture from the air and speed up the drying process. We’ll ensure that your home is thoroughly dry and safe before completing the job.
Step 4: Cleaning and Sanitizing
Once the drying process is complete, our team will clean and sanitize the affected area to prevent mold and mildew growth. We’ll also ensure that all affected materials are properly disposed of.
Step 5: Restoration and Repair
Finally, we’ll work with you to restore your home to its pre-loss condition. This may include repairing or replacing damaged materials, such as drywall or flooring. We’ll work closely with you to ensure that the final result meets your expectations.

Basement Water Extraction vs. DIY: When to Call a Professional
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Small leak in a corner of the basement | Yes | No | DIY can handle small leaks with minimal damage. |
| Large area of standing water in the basement | No | Large areas of standing water need professional equipment and expertise. | |
| Musty odors and visible mold growth | No | Mold growth needs professional remediation to prevent health hazards. | |
| Water damage to structural elements, such as joists or beams | No | Water damage to structural elements needs professional assessment and repair. | |
| Excessive moisture in the air and high humidity levels | No | Excessive moisture needs professional dehumidification and drying techniques. | |
| Water damage to electrical parts or appliances | No | Water damage to electrical parts needs professional assessment and repair to prevent electrical shock. |

Basement Water Extraction Cost in El Lago, TX
The cost of Basement Water Extraction in El Lago, TX can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our team will provide a detailed, itemized estimate for your job, so you know exactly what you’re paying for.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water Extraction and Drying |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and local conditions. |
| Dehumidification and Moisture Control | $200 – $1,000 | Size of affected area, level of moisture, and local conditions. |
| Cleaning and Sanitizing | $100 – $500 | Size of affected area, type of materials, and level of contamination. |
| Restoration and Repair | $500 – $5,000 | Size of affected area, type of materials, and level of damage. |
| Equipment Rental and Maintenance | $100 – $500 | Size of affected area, type of equipment, and local conditions. |
| Project Management and Coordination | $100 – $500 | Size of affected area, level of complexity, and local conditions. |
